Title: Re: matw/amatw/latw
Post by: redsforlife on Jun 02, 2013, 08:56: AM
I would say you should learn matw before amatw, and I'd say it goes the same for tatw and atatw. Once you get them, you might realize you prefer an alternative to the original, but I think you need to learn the originals first. They are easier to learn in the beginning. I actually prefer amatw to matw now.

As for latw, it's completely different to the other moves you mentioned. Other than it obviously being an atw based trick, it's about as different a skillset as it gets for atw based tricks compared to matw to latw. I would say it really just depends on the individual which is easier.
